Scaffolding is a special structure that serves as a support during work. It also withstands heavy loads. For workers, this design serves as a fixture that provides a comfortable and safe working environment.

Scaffolding is suitable for any kind of interior work. With the help of these devices it is convenient to paint the surface, plaster or putty the walls. The structure itself usually consists of flooring and metal supports. People and the tools they need can freely be on the floor.

Types and types of scaffolding

Depending on the purpose, there are several types of scaffolding:

  • for stone work;
  • repair work;
  • protective structures.

The scaffolding itself (construction and others) must withstand heavy loads. They should also be light in construction and quickly dismantled when finished.

Stationary scaffolding

One of those types that is indispensable for repairs. The system consists of so-called "blocks": racks, beams, flooring, fastenings, and so on.

Stationary scaffolds are divided into single-row and double-row. In the first case, put only one row of racks. They are connected to each other with lags.

To build such a scaffold, racks are buried in the ground with a slight slope to a depth of about 1 meter and the hole is carefully buried. There are also posts at the corners, which can be extended with wire strapping.

Working scaffolds

These devices serve mainly as a workplace. The main requirement is sustainability.

In turn, this species is divided into 6 groups:

  1. I group is used for elementary work like measurements. Moreover, only one person can stand on such a structure. The tool he works with should be light.
  2. II group can be used for work like maintenance, such as cleaning the facade. The maximum load in this case should not exceed 150 kg per 1 square meter.
  3. III group is scaffolding, which is used most often when puttying surfaces and other similar works.

The rest of the scaffold groups are designed for stone, tile and other work.

Types of scaffolding

The following varieties are also distinguished.

  1. Gantry scaffolding. In the building there are special tubular goats (most often steel), which are installed on a solid foundation, and flooring is laid on top. In general, the height of the scaffolds should not exceed 4 meters. In turn, these structures are connected by horizontal ligaments, the distance between which is no more than 2.75 m. Sometimes they are moved apart. Then the distance should be no more than 2 meters.
  2. Frame scaffolding. This is an installation of pipes (usually aluminum), which are welded to the frames. The latter do not move. It is very simple, easy and fast to assemble such a design and disassemble. In certain places, special puffs are placed. Sometimes irregularities appear, in which case they can be leveled using the so-called spindle supports. If you put wheels on them, then the scaffolding can be rolled from place to place.
  3. Modular systems. On racks, this type of device has special anchor points for installing various elements.
  4. Boom platforms are used for protection. There are steel profiles (or beams) made of wood that are used as load-bearing consoles. Approximately 1.5 meters distance between these fixtures.
  5. Console scaffolding. The purpose is the samelike the riflemen. Separate consoles are made in the form of triangles. They put reinforced concrete floors on which they are fixed. The flooring is solid. It is usually made from boards up to 4 cm thick. Two hanging loops are installed on each console.
  6. Rack scaffolding. They are made from racks in the form of pipes. There is a lower part that is fixed. Another pipe with a diameter of about 60 mm is inserted into this part. Wooden shoulder straps are laid on the inner pipe, on which the flooring is then installed.
  7. Inventory scaffolding. If you have to lengthen them, then folding supports are applied to the bottom. Themselves overall, but weigh little. There should be no gaps between the wall and the shield, but if there are, then they must be blocked. This design is very convenient for working in tight spaces, such as bathrooms and the like.
  8. Hinged platform. This is a structure, the supports of which are metal, the flooring is plank. Mounted on two supports. Pretty high load capacity.

Protection scaffolding

The main purpose is to protect people and tools from falling. Also, the part on top protects against objects falling from above. Protective roofs are usually installed on sidewalks, driveways, entrances and other similar places.

Wooden beams or metal frames are used as the floor. The distance from the wall to the floor must be at least 30 cm. There are also catching scaffolds, along with which special nets are installed to stop a person from falling. The cover must fit snugly against the wall to prevent people below from getting dust or materials on them. Its width must be at least 1.5 meters.

When inspecting scaffolds, it is worth saying that they have load-bearing elements, which are steel and aluminum pipes protected from corrosion. Their thickness should be more than 2 mm. The flooring can be made of wooden beams. There may also be metal options that, with the help of corrugations, provide non-slip safety. The flooring must be firmly laid and not sway. The lateral protection consists of the top and intermediate crossbeam. The 10 cm wide board on the board prevents falling. Railing - up to 1 meter high.

Features of choice

As for the choice of specific scaffolds, it all depends on their scope. If in doubt, it is best to consult a specialist. Basically, when choosing, it is worth considering some points. For example, the problem being solved. Lightweight and compact designs with a height of about 3 m are suitable for small-sized work.

For a larger event, systems with increased strength and rigidity are recommended. In addition, they must be stable in order to ensure maximum safety for people. The presence of a fence should also be taken into account.

Such structures must necessarily have connecting elements that ensure the strength of the structure. Use bolts, couplings or consoles. Anchors are used to attach scaffolds.elements. Stepladders are placed on the scaffold for access. They should be installed inside at an angle of 70 degrees. Now quite often they sell designs with built-in ladders. Such a device is more convenient and saves working time during descent and ascent.
